最近项目中使用到了FTP服务器,于是就进行学习了一下。项目真实的FTP环境是在客户方的,所以为了在项目开发中方便,就根据网上的资料搭建了一个FTP服务器,然后用java实现了一下对ftp的操作。
当然网上已经有了很多这方面的资料,主要是为了稳固刚学到的知识,所以将自己搭建的过程和代码的编写进行记录下来。
ftp环境搭建
首先,选择一个ftp服务器软件,我选择FileZilla Server这个软件还不错,百度上能够直接搜到,免费的。
软件的安装过程如果没有太大的需求,基本上下一步下一步就行,一直到安装完毕。这个就不列了。
安装好的界面应该是这样的,当然我这个已经运行了。
接下来就是添加用户,这个用户用来进行登录使用,之后再Java代码中也会用到。
点击edit->users->general->add 填写用户名,然后点击enable account 设置密码,除用户名外,与下图保持一致即可,点击ok。
添加完用户后需要添加一个ftp共享目录,以后